University Admission Tests
TMUA, MAT, ENGAA
If you are applying to study Maths or Engineering at one of the top universities (including Oxford, Cambridge, Imperial, Durham etc,) you will need to sit their admissions test, usually in October (TMUA, ENGAA, MAT). Early preparation is crucial for these. I recommend starting in September at the very latest, and I offer weekly sessions with lots of resources to help you achieve your best in these challenging assessments.
